The National Audubon Society is seeking a Director for the Mississippi River Program to lead its water conservation strategy aimed at enhancing habitats and ensuring clean water. This hybrid position allows for remote work within the United States, preferably for candidates located near New Orleans, LA. Qualified candidates will possess extensive experience in policy and advocacy, particularly related to water management and conservation initiatives. The role involves building coalitions, manag…
